Thibault Boulvain is Assistant Professor of Art History at Sciences Po. He co-directs the "Arts and Societies" seminar with Laurence Bertrand Dorléac. He is the author of numerous books, including and L'art en sida. 1981-1997 (Presses du réel, 2021).

Mathieu Fulla is a researcher at CHSP and a lecturer at Sciences Po (PRAG). He is qualified to supervise research, and his work focuses on the history of the left in Europe in the 20th century, the history of the state, and the history of capitalism.
